Erika Harano (she/they) is a queer, mixed race, genderfluid, Japanese movement artist and facilitator who uses dance to explore complexity, emergence, interdependence, and relationships. Erika joined Consuming Kinetics Dance Company as a company artist and educator in 2019, and is deeply committed to youth leadership development and intergenerational artistry within the company.
Erika is a [design] educator who co-creates spaces to critically interrogate and shift dominant systems of power. they are a co-founder of the emerging worker cooperative Next World Teams, which focuses on supporting people and teams in anti-racism + anti-oppression work.
